Output deb03de89589ce21a217fcfa752bc4397e7c00963a1aa172934575c437df737e:3

value
1125867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 755de80159ac21a5f8337c4fbc7668082a6aec12 OP_EQUALVERIFY OP_CHECKSIG
address
1BhaZAeBppK3w7i6GWGZHWK7Up4XL8aQck
transaction
deb03de89589ce21a217fcfa752bc4397e7c00963a1aa172934575c437df737e
spent
true